Web2.Press the 2nd button and the Y = button to access the STAT PLOT menu. 3.Scroll to the plot you want. This is probably 1: Plot1...On. Press ENTER . Make sure the other plots are turned Off unless you really want more than one plot in your graph. 4.Highlight On. 5.Scroll down to Type:. Highlight the histogram icon, and press ENTER . brendan\u0027s backpack
